1. Introduction of Smart Storage Soutions
Smart storage systems are one of the most significant innovations in LPG storage. These systems use sensors, real-time data analytics, and IoT (Internet of Things) technology to monitor and manage LPG storage tanks. By tracking the levels of LPG, temperature, and pressure, these smart systems help prevent leaks, optimize storage space, and improve safety. Additionally, they enable operators to forecast LPG demand and ensure timely replenishment of supply.
2. Modular Storage Solution for Flexibility
Modular storage solutions have become increasingly popular in the LPG industry due to their flexibility and scalability. These storage units can be easily expanded or downsized based on demand, making them ideal for both large-scale operations and smaller, regional storage needs. Modular tanks allow for quick deployment in areas with fluctuating demand, ensuring a more responsive and adaptable supply chain.

4. Distribution Network Optimization with GPS and AI
Advancements in GPS technology and Artificial Intelligence (AI) have improved the distribution network of LPG. GPS systems enable real-time tracking of delivery trucks, ensuring efficient route planning and timely deliveries. AI is being used to analyze traffic patterns, weather conditions, and customer demand, allowing distributors to optimize routes and reduce delivery costs. These innovations are making LPG distribution more reliable and cost-effective.
5. Sustainable Transport and Delivery Solutions
With the growing emphasis on sustainability/ LPG distributors are increasingly adopting greener transportation solutions. Electric or hybrid LPG delivery trucks are being introduced to reduce carbon emissions. Moreover, companies are exploring alternative fuels for transport, such as compressed natural gas (CNG) and biogas, which further reduces the environmental impact of LPG distribution.
6. Enhanced Safety Measures in Storage and Transportation
Safety has always been a priority in the LPG industry, and recent innovations are making storage and transportation even safer. Advanced leak detection systems, improved tank design, and better pressure-relief valves are some of the key safety advancements. Additionally, training programs and safety protocols are being continuously updated to minimize risks during storage and distribution.
7. Integration of Blockchain for Transparency and Efficiency
Blockchain technology is beginning to find its way into LPG distribution networks, offering solutions for transparency and efficiency. Blockchain helps track the entire journey of LPG, from production to delivery, creating a secure, tamper-proof ledger of transactions. This technology enhances trust between suppliers, distributors, and consumers while minimizing fraud and errors.
